What to Expect When You Arrive
The adventure begins right at the heart of downtown Austin, at 405 Red River Street. We liked how straightforward the process is: upon arrival, a friendly guide greets you and provides a briefing on your chosen game. You’ll spend around 15 minutes getting oriented, understanding the rules, and preparing for your mission. Then, it’s into the rooms where the real fun begins.
The rooms are designed with creativity and clarity. Unlike some escape rooms that lean into dark, scary themes, these are lively, adventurous, and family-friendly. No dark corridors or horror elements here—just engaging puzzles and clues set in well-themed environments. For example, in “Gold Rush,” you’re hunting for treasure in California hills, while “Prison Break” challenges you to escape an evil warden’s clutches.
The Five Unique Adventures
You can pick from these options:
- Gold Rush: Find hidden treasure in the California hills—perfect if you love history or treasure hunts.
- Prison Break: Escape from behind bars before the clock runs out—ideal for fans of daring escapes.
- The Heist: Recover a stolen masterpiece from a cunning art thief—great for those who love puzzles and art themes.
- Playground: Complete a report card to kick off summer—fun for families with kids.
- Classified: Uncover a secret plot as a spy—suits those who like espionage stories.
- Timeliner: Save the future by traveling through time—suitable for sci-fi fans.
- The Depths: Reveal lab secrets—aimed at science enthusiasts.
- Cosmic Crisis: Destroy a black hole threatening Earth—perfect for space buffs.
Each game lasts 60 minutes, with an additional 15-minute briefing and debrief afterward, including time for photos. This structure ensures a relaxed start and a chance to reflect on your success (or near escape).

Accessibility and Practical Details
Participants need to be at least 13 years old; younger kids are allowed but might find some puzzles tough. An adult must participate with children under 14 and sign waivers for minors. The activity is near public transportation, making it easy to access without a car, and service animals are welcome.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is this activity suitable for children?
Yes, most travelers aged 13 and up can participate. Children under 14 need an adult present, and all minors require a waiver signed by an adult.
How long does the experience last?
Expect approximately 1 hour and 15 minutes, including briefing and debrief, with the actual game lasting 60 minutes.
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el for free up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.
